From 667a7a4285d4e97ed5242e60df909f3ecdd35d59 Mon Sep 17 00:00:00 2001 From: René 'Necoro' Neumann Date: Mon, 11 Jan 2016 21:42:45 +0100 Subject: Started to include const expense groups --- static/js/kosten.ls | 18 ++++++++++++++++++ 1 file changed, 18 insertions(+) (limited to 'static/js/kosten.ls') diff --git a/static/js/kosten.ls b/static/js/kosten.ls index ea433a4..f9876f8 100644 --- a/static/js/kosten.ls +++ b/static/js/kosten.ls @@ -58,6 +58,24 @@ $ !-> $ \input.search .focusout !-> $ \form.search .hide! +# Consts +export editConstJS = jq !-> + group = $ \select#group + category = $ \select#category + + group .change !-> + val = group .find \option:selected .val! + if category_data[val] == void # no group selected + category .prop \disabled false + else + category + ..find \option:selected .prop \selected false + ..find "option[value=#{category_data[val]}]" .prop \selected true + ..prop \disabled true + + # initial + group .change! + # Add export addJS = jq !-> $ 'input[name=date]' -- cgit v1.2.3-70-g09d2